WebA microchannel plate ( MCP) is used to detect single particles ( electrons, ions and neutrons [1]) and photons ( ultraviolet radiation and X-rays ). It is closely related to an electron multiplier, as both intensify single particles or photons by the multiplication of electrons via secondary emission, [2] however because a microchannel plate ...
